SUBJECT: LEBANON: KUWAIT RESPONSE ON JUNE 23
RECONSTRUCTION CONFERENCE
REF: STATE 60216
Classified By: Ambassador Deborah K. Jones for Reasons 1.4 (b) and (d)
1. (C) In response to reftel request seeking host country
support for the June 23 reconstruction conference on
Lebanon's Nahr Al-Barid refugee camp, Econcouns spoke with
Ambassador Jassim Al-Mubaraki, MFA Director of Arab Affairs,
on June 5. Al-Mubaraki said he had just met with the
Lebanese CDA and Austrian Ambassador to discuss the event.
He said Kuwait would "definitely" participate in the
conference with a "high-ranking official," but he could not
confirm the official or the amount of Kuwait's contribution
at the present time.
2. (C) Al-Mubaraki continued that the only "reservation" the
GOK had about the proposed conference was that participants
and the international community not consider it a "solution"
to the refugee problem. The solution to the refugee problem
in Nahr Al-Barid and elsewhere, Al-Mubaraki stated, was a
return to a homeland along the lines of President Bush's
two-state solution for Palestinians and Israelis. Thus the
conference needed to stress the need for progress on Middle
East peace as the best means toward ending the Palestinian
refugee problem.
3. (C) That said, Al-Mubaraki emphasized that Kuwait was
committed to the stability of Lebanon and would make a
"generous donation" at the event.
